Spotify has opened up their podcasting section to all anyone to upload their podcasts to the service.

Spotify won’t be hosting the podcasts directly. Instead, producers will provide the streaming service with a link to their podcast feed, after which Spotify will list it and make the podcast available to its 180 million users.

Spotify is not providing podcasters with a revenue share on plays, as Spotify expects that all podcasters will be monetizing from within the podcast itself. Instead, Spotify will provide information on who is listening to the podcasts, which will no doubt be especially helpful to podcasts with paying advertisers.

Apple and Google are very strong in the podcasting market on both iOS and Android devices. Apple has a reported market share of 55 percent as of 2017.
